hive无法进入命令行
时间: 2023-11-07 17:05:20 浏览: 77
如果您无法进入 Hive 命令行,可能是由于以下原因:
1. Hive 未正确安装或配置:请确保已正确安装并配置了 Hive,并且路径设置正确。
2. Hadoop 集群未正常运行:请确保 Hadoop 集群已正确运行,并且配置正确。
3. Hive 服务未启动:请确保 Hive 服务已启动,并且正在运行。
4. 端口号被占用:请检查是否有其他进程正在占用端口号,如果是,请尝试更改端口号或停止占用端口号的进程。
5. 日志文件错误:请检查日志文件或日志级别,以查看是否有任何错误或异常信息。
如果您遇到任何问题,请尝试重新启动 Hive 和 Hadoop 并检查配置文件是否正确。如果问题仍然存在,请查看 Hive 和 Hadoop 的日志文件以获取更多信息。
相关问题
进入hive命令行界面
要进入Hive命令行界面,可以使用以下两种方式:
1. 直接输入/hive/bin/hive的执行程序,或者输入hive –service cli命令,用于Linux平台命令行查询。在命令行中输入以上命令后,即可进入Hive命令行界面。
2. 使用远程服务方式启动Hive(端口号10000),然后通过jdbc等驱动访问Hive。具体启动方式为:nohup hive –service hiveserver &。这种方式适用于程序员需要通过编程语言访问Hive的情况。
linux进入hive命令行
要进入Hive命令行,需要先在Linux系统中安装Hive。安装完成后,可以通过以下步骤进入Hive命令行:
1. 打开终端,输入hive命令并按下回车键。
2. 如果Hive已经正确安装并配置,终端将显示Hive命令行提示符。
3. 在Hive命令行中,可以输入各种Hive命令来执行数据查询、数据操作等操作。
需要注意的是,进入Hive命令行前,需要先启动Hadoop集群。另外,还需要确保Hive的配置文件中指定了正确的Hadoop集群地址和端口号。